[CP] fix failed cases caused by cherry-pick code

This commit is contained in:
wangt1xiuyi
2023-07-12 08:12:22 +00:00
committed by ob-robot
parent 7af90145c2
commit ef8f47dc40
2 changed files with 3 additions and 5 deletions

View File

@ -354,8 +354,7 @@ int ObDbmsStatsUtils::split_batch_write(sql::ObExecContext &ctx,
ObIArray<ObOptColumnStat*> &column_stats, ObIArray<ObOptColumnStat*> &column_stats,
const bool is_index_stat/*default false*/, const bool is_index_stat/*default false*/,
const bool is_history_stat/*default false*/, const bool is_history_stat/*default false*/,
const bool is_online_stat /*default false*/, const bool is_online_stat /*default false*/)
const ObObjPrintParams &print_params)
{ {
int ret = OB_SUCCESS; int ret = OB_SUCCESS;
int64_t idx_tab_stat = 0; int64_t idx_tab_stat = 0;
@ -418,7 +417,7 @@ int ObDbmsStatsUtils::split_batch_write(sql::ObExecContext &ctx,
is_index_stat, is_index_stat,
is_history_stat, is_history_stat,
is_online_stat, is_online_stat,
print_params))) { CREATE_OBJ_PRINT_PARAM(ctx.get_my_session())))) {
LOG_WARN("failed to batch write stats", K(ret), K(idx_tab_stat), K(idx_col_stat)); LOG_WARN("failed to batch write stats", K(ret), K(idx_tab_stat), K(idx_col_stat));
} else {/*do nothing*/} } else {/*do nothing*/}
} }

View File

@ -44,8 +44,7 @@ public:
ObIArray<ObOptColumnStat*> &column_stats, ObIArray<ObOptColumnStat*> &column_stats,
const bool is_index_stat = false, const bool is_index_stat = false,
const bool is_history_stat = false, const bool is_history_stat = false,
const bool is_online_stat = false, const bool is_online_stat = false);
const ObObjPrintParams &print_params = ObObjPrintParams());
static int batch_write_history_stats(sql::ObExecContext &ctx, static int batch_write_history_stats(sql::ObExecContext &ctx,
ObIArray<ObOptTableStatHandle> &history_tab_handles, ObIArray<ObOptTableStatHandle> &history_tab_handles,